摘要
The rate at which research ideas can be prototyped is significantly increased when re-useable software components are employed. A mission of the Computational Infrastructure for Operations Research (COIN-OR) initiative is to promote the development and use of re-useable open-source tools for operations research professionals. In this paper, we introduce the COIN-OR initiative and survey recent progress in integer programming that utilizes COIN-OR components. In particular, we present an implementation of an algorithm for finding integer-optimal solutions to a cutting-stock problem.
